Nakarara Primary School Well Project – Tanzania

Location Nakarara, Masasi district, Mtwara region, Tanzania Community Description Nakara village spans over 20 square kilometers and is situated between the Nakarara River and the beginning of the Makonde Plateau. Ilima School Water Project – Tanzania

Location Rungwe District, Mbeya Region, Tanzania Community Description The Ilima Secondary School is located on a steep ridge of the Poroto Mountains. School Water Catchment and Piping Project – Tanzania

Located in central East Africa, Tanzania is bordered by Kenya and Uganda to the north, Rwanda, Burundi and the Democratic Republic of the Congo to the west, and Zambia, Malawi and Mozambique to the south, and the Indian Ocean on the East.
